悠悠楠杉
如何检测域名是否被墙:实用技巧与工具指南
一、理解“被墙”现象
“被墙”是指在中国大陆地区,由于各种原因(如政治、法律、安全等),特定网站或其IP地址被中国政府或电信部门阻止访问的现象。这种限制通常通过DNS污染或IP封锁实现,使得特定域名在中国的网络环境中无法解析或访问。
二、检测方法与工具
直接访问法:最直接的检测方式是尝试从中国大陆的IP地址直接访问该域名。如果页面加载失败或显示“无法访问”的错误信息,则很可能是被墙了。但这种方法受限于本地网络环境,可能因其他原因导致误判。
Ping测试:使用命令行工具(如Windows的
ping
命令或Linux的ping
命令)对域名执行ping操作,观察是否能够成功接收回复。如果无法收到回复,可能意味着域名已被墙。但这种方法不提供完整的访问状态,仅能作为初步判断。使用专业工具:
- Whois查询:通过查询域名的WHOIS信息,可以了解其注册地、IP地址等基本信息,间接判断是否可能因地域限制而无法访问。
- DNS解析工具:如
dig
或nslookup
,可以检查DNS解析是否正常。如果解析出非预期的IP地址(如127.0.0.53等),则很可能是被墙了。 - 网络代理/VPN测试:使用网络代理(如代理服务器)或VPN服务连接到其他国家/地区的网络环境,再尝试访问该域名。如果此时能正常访问,则说明该域名确实在中国大陆被墙。
云服务提供商的帮助:许多云服务提供商(如阿里云、腾讯云)提供“全球加速”或“CDN”服务,它们可以帮助你绕过地域限制,测试域名的真实可访问性。
三、法律与隐私考虑
在尝试检测域名是否被墙的过程中,必须注意以下几点法律与隐私的考量:
- 遵守当地法律:确保你的检测行为不违反任何国家的法律法规,尤其是涉及网络安全和隐私保护的法律。
- 使用代理/VPN的合法性:虽然使用代理/VPN在全球范围内是常见的行为,但在某些国家/地区可能是非法的。务必确保你的行为合法且符合当地的法律规定。
- 数据保护:在处理任何形式的网络活动时,都应保护好个人隐私和数据安全,避免因不当操作而泄露个人信息。
四、应对策略与建议
- 了解背景:在采取任何行动之前,先了解为何该域名可能被墙,是否涉及法律风险等。有时直接联系网站所有者或相关机构可能是解决问题的最快途径。
- 使用合法的绕过工具:在了解相关法律和风险后,可以考虑使用合法的代理/VPN服务来绕过地域限制,但需确保服务提供方是可信赖的。
- 多元化访问渠道:探索除网页浏览器外的其他访问方式,如移动应用、特定国家的镜像站点等。
- 支持合法合规的海外服务:鼓励和支持那些已经采取措施确保在全球范围内合法运营的网站和服务。
结论:
检测域名是否被墙是一个需要结合多种技术手段和法律意识的过程。通过上述方法与工具的应用,以及对法律与隐私的审慎考虑,我们可以更有效地判断并应对这一现象。在这个过程中,理解“被墙”背后的技术原理和法律环境同样重要,以确保我们的行为既合法又有效。